Eligibility Criteria
- Nationality: Any nationality
- Education: Master's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Industrial and Organizational Psychology, Social Sciences, or a related field from an accredited academic institution
- Experience: 2 years of relevant professional experience, or 4 years of experience with a Bachelor's degree
- Language: Fluency in English and French (oral and written); working knowledge of another official UN language is an advantage
- Certifications: Demonstrated writing skills, good knowledge of IOM/UN HR policies and staff rules and regulations, excellent organization skills, analytical and creative thinking, and ability to prepare clear and concise reports
